Output 43ccc6c1a662f09b66e50da2190f4cf80daa6cc3f52195bf6e1fbf5eddece44e:8

value
3305812
script pubkey
OP_0 OP_PUSHBYTES_20 e343893c51f1d7883f04dbb98a48b80dc4654cc8
address
bc1qudpcj0z378tcs0cymwuc5j9cphzx2nxgtvtrju
transaction
43ccc6c1a662f09b66e50da2190f4cf80daa6cc3f52195bf6e1fbf5eddece44e
spent
true